Oil, hormones, and bacteria usually cause acne. When sebum cannot escape the skin pores due to the oil residue, bacteria, and dead skin cells clog the follicles, it eventually leads to acne.

What is the Skin Care Routine for Acne-Prone Skin?

It is immensely crucial for you to apply the best skin care products for acne-prone skin. Also, ensure you don’t use too many products and always check the label for ingredients. If you have acne-prone skin, use non-acnegenic, non-comedogenic and oil-free products.

After you have sorted out the most appropriate products for your skin, then you should follow this acne-prone skincare routine:

  • Firstly, you need to wash your face gently with a cleanser. Make sure that you don’t over-cleanse your face. Keep away from cleansers that overly dry your face and irritte the skin. Such cleansers may temporarily give you an oil-free feeling but add to the misery! How? Drier the skin, more sebum will be produced which will lead to more acne.
  • Secondly, gently pat your skin with a soft towel and allow it to dry. Apply a serum with actives like niacinamide, salicylic acid, glycolic acid to treat and prevent acne.
  • Thirdly, you need to apply a non-greasy moisturiser on your face. Leave it for a few minutes until your skin completely absorbs the product.
  • Fourthly, you shouldn’t miss out on sunscreen. Applying SPF on your face will protect your skin from the sun's harmful rays.
  • Fifthly, once you return home, make sure you cleanse your face. This will help remove the makeup and debris accumulated on your face.

Morning & Night Skin Care Routine for Acne-Prone Skin

Here, we’ve listed the steps for both morning and night skincare routines for acne-prone skin.

The step-by-step morning routine for acne-prone skin is as follows:

  • Step 1: Cleanser
  • Step 2: Toner
  • Step 3: Moisturiser
  • Step 4: Sunscreen
  • Step 5: Makeup

The step-by-step night skincare routine for acne-prone skin is as follows:

  • Step 1: Makeup Remover
  • Step 2: Cleanser
  • Step 3: Spot Treatment
